Kiowa County Junior High/High School

Regular School · Greensburg, KS

Kiowa County Junior High/High School is a regular school school in Greensburg, Kansas, serving grades 06–12 with 131 students enrolled (SY 2024-2025). The student-teacher ratio is 7.8:1.
